RATING

----The show dropped a little from last week, but finished with an overall rating of 1.1 [17815 viewers].  The show opened with over 11,000 viewers and finished with close to 18,000 viewers.  They had an increase in the 3rd quarter during the Yung vs Ga Ga match, but then lost some of the viewers for the main event.  Even though it did jump two quarters and drop for the last quarter, overall it was plus from start to finish.

----I did not enjoy the interaction between Mercer and Jenkins.  Here is why - if Jenkins is not scared of Mercer, then why would a wrestler be scared of him??...What was the real story behind the finish of Mercer vs Lee?? It seem to be a messed up count [from Two time RRO Referee of the Year Downtown Bruno], but it was a fun upset for Lee.  Good solid bout and have to agree with Larry Goodman on this - probably the best bout on TV so far. Lee did his signature moves of running shooting star and split-leg moonsault. He looked real good...Baxter did a great job again this week putting over Lee and the talent.  Baxter is really a rookie when it comes to being an announcer, but it does help that he has been around and works in front of mic every day at this shoot job.  But, here is something he does that every announcer should be doing - listen real close to him putting over ALL THE TALENT that is in the ring. By doing that, then he is putting over the match, putting over the quality of the talent and making the viewer think he is watching an important match without ever saying "this is a match of a year" or whatever.
